Resumo

The main goal of this study is to investigate the magnetic properties of topsoils in an area of about16 Km2 near Coimbra. Also, the possible linkages between contents on heavy metals and magnetic parameters were investigated. 104 surface samples were taken over a square grid with a cell size ot500 m, and at various distances from the main roads. Laboratory measurements of high- and low-field susceptibilities were performed using Bartington MS2 dual-frequency meter. Direct magneticfields up to 3T were used to acquire isothermal remanent magnetization using MM PM 9 magnetizer,measured with a Molspin Minispin magnetometer. A subset of these soil samples (N=39) were analyzed for Pb, Zn, Co, Cu, Cr and Ni by using atomic absorption spectroscopy (Perkin-Elmer 2380). Susceptibility values are in the range 6 to 325x1 O'5SI and MRI1T values in the range 0.25 to 18.174 A/m.High correlation coefficients between these two parameters were found (r=0.8). Higher values ofboth parameters were reported near roads and rivers. S-ratios (IRM WOm/SIRM and lRM 300m/S!RM)and IRM acquisition curves indicated the presence of ferrimagnetic minerals. Concentrations of Pb(=115 mg/Kg), Ni (=48mg/Kg), Zn (=387 mg/Kg) and Cu (=78mg/Kg) were higher than the mean background values for the world soils; urban pollution and emission from vehicles seem to be the mainreason for these values; for the agricultural soils, chemical products (e.g. fertilizers) are the responsible for the high concentrations in those elements. Positive correlation was found between Pb andIRM, and also between Cu and IRM (0.4 and 0.5 respectively).
